The promising antibody ADG-2 has developed a group of specialists from several US research institutions, non-profit organizations and two biotechnological firms. The results of their work scientists have published in the reviewed journal Science American Association for the Development of Science (AAAS).

Despite the impressive achievements in creating vaccines forming immunity to Coronavirus SARS-COV-2, the COVID-19 causative agent, their long-term effectiveness is still questionable. Not so much due to the shortcomings of the drugs themselves, as much as the ability of viruses very quickly mutate. Moreover, the majority of already approved and only undergoing vaccine tests are used as the target of the same part of the virion.

We are talking about special structures on the shell of the viral capsid, which are responsible for attaching to the infected cell - Receptor Binding Domain (RBD). These areas are subject to constant mutations and can vary greatly between strains of even one virus, not to mention related species. Therefore, American researchers focused their efforts on creating antibodies that may be more versatile.

Such agents are called broad spectrum antibodies (Broadly Neutralizing antibodies, Bnabs) and can be the basis of universal vaccines capable of protecting immediately from a whole family of viruses. And by long experiments, it was possible to create several candidates: ADG-1, ADG-2 and ADG-3. As a result of the selection, the connection with the ADG-2 code was the most effective.

Its ability to attack to coronavirus checked on the culture of mouse cells, and it is impressive. ADG-2 effectively connects to more than three dozen variations of the ill-fated SARS-COV-2, which is now terrorizing humanity. Scientists have experienced a promising body on virions of various strains, in which RBD is significantly different. What is most interesting, ADG-2 showed a high ability to attach to various "relatives" of the cavities of COVID-19 - Sarbecovirus subfamily viruses.
